HL Deb 15 July 1861 vol 164 c875

On the Motion of Earl GRANVILLE, Select Committee appointed to consider and report in what Manner the Conditions annexed by the Will of the late Mr. Turner, R.A., to the Bequest of his Pictures to the Trustees of the National Gallery can best be carried out: And, having completed such Inquiry, then to consider and report the Measures proper to be taken with respect to the Vernon Galley, and the prospective Measures proper to be taken with respect to any future Gifts of same Kind.

The Lords following were named of the Committee:—

Ld. President L. Stanley of Alderley.
M. Lansdowne, L. Monteagle of Brandon.
M. Salisbury. L. Elgin.
M. Northampton. L. Overstone.
E. Derby. L. Cranworth.
E. Stanhope. L. St. Leonards.
L. Foley. L. Chelmsford.
L. Colchester. L. Taunton.
L. Ashburton.
